Let’s dive into some creative ideas that will make your barndominium kitchen the heart of your home.Open Concept LayoutsOne of the most appealing aspects of a barndominium kitchen is the open concept layout. This allows for seamless flow between the kitchen, dining, and living areas. Imagine hosting a dinner party where guests can mingle as you whip up a delicious meal. Incorporating a large island can provide additional seating and workspace, making it a multifunctional hub. Plus, using contrasting colors for the island and cabinetry can create a stunning focal point.Rustic Materials and FinishesUsing rustic materials like reclaimed wood, stone, and metal can enhance the farmhouse feel of your barndominium kitchen. Think about exposed beams, shiplap walls, and distressed cabinetry. These elements not only add character but also create a warm and inviting atmosphere. Pairing these finishes with modern appliances can strike the perfect balance between old and new.Functional Storage SolutionsIn any kitchen, especially in a barndominium, effective storage is key. Consider incorporating open shelving made from reclaimed wood to display your favorite dishes and decor. This not only saves space but also adds visual interest. Additionally, using cabinets that reach the ceiling can maximize storage while adding height to the room.Lighting That Sets the MoodLighting is a crucial element in any kitchen design. In a barndominium kitchen, consider using large pendant lights over the island for a dramatic effect. You can also mix in softer lighting under cabinets to create a warm ambiance. Don’t forget about natural light; large windows can brighten up the space and showcase the beautiful surroundings.FAQQ: What is a barndominium?A: A barndominium is a type of home that combines a barn-like structure with living quarters.
